Output 72ec66c3bbe154db85d4631494b3a94299e01e879dce2a15e1cdfdc31e0963ff:16

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23c5bdf2f12c1d3d55d62a4827443b59266388ed0532145e4d6698541bef1f58
address
tb1py0zmmuh39swn64wk9fyzw3pmtynx8z8dq5epghjdv6v9gxl0ravqw79udw
transaction
72ec66c3bbe154db85d4631494b3a94299e01e879dce2a15e1cdfdc31e0963ff
confirmations
50336
spent
true